Since it seems some people can't find where the previous post I was referencing is:

Just to set the record straight .. RAVE does stand for Rosemount, Apple Valley and Eastview. We haven't had a Rosemount player for atleast 5 years now but through the cost of jeserys we decided not to change our name. We had 22 players tryout this year (4 from Eastview and 18 Apple Valley). We kept 17 skaters and 2 goalies and the others are currently playing for the Rosemount U-16 team.

Because our name contains 3 schools doesn't necessarily mean what some of you think. We have 15 Apple Valley and 4 Eastview players and find it hard to believe that other teams dont have a mix from different schools themselves. As a matter of a fact I know that the majority of all teams do.


To avoid confusion and people thinking that we are pulling from 3 schools, think of it this way: we represent the city of Apple Valley that contains two fairly large high schools (Apple Valley/Eastview). So much like Lakeville, we get the next best 70 skaters or so that live in Apple Valley.

Sorry to hear about being cut, you guys. It really bothers me that - that happens to so many gifted players that deserve to play at that level.

Some HS coaches will cut the experienced seniors and replace them with similar ability underclassman. What those coaches neglect to understand is that the underclassman, although they may have similar abilities, are less mature than the Seniors and they tend to panic under pressure. Just look at several of the HS playoff games where teams that "should have won" LOST. As I watched several of these recent games play out - I realized that so many of the mistakes and breakdowns were due to younger, less poised players.

I saw a recent post on another site where a scout was complaining about this very same thing. He posed the question... "How many College Coaches cut Seniors for underclassman?" The point being - if college coaches don't cut their seniors - why would a High School coach cut his???
